Bartolinos Meatballs

Ingredients

  • 1 egg, slightly
  • 2 tablespoons snipped fresh parsley
  • 1 to 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on dried Italian seasoning or 1/2 teaspoon dried rosemary, crushed
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 pound lean ground beef beaten

Preparation

Step 1

1In a large bowl, combine egg, bread crumbs, Parmesan cheese, onion, parsley, garlic, Italian seasoning or rosemary, salt, and pepper. Add ground beef; mix well. Shape into 28 meatballs about 1-1/2 inches in diameter.2Arrange meatballs in a 15x10x1-inch baking pan. Bake in a 350 degree F oven for 15 to 20 minutes or till done (no pink remains, 160 degrees F). Drain off fat. Makes 4 to 6 servings.3Tip: To cook meatballs in a skillet, prepare as above through step 1. In a large skillet cook half the meatballs at a time in 1 tablespoon hot butter over medium heat about 10 minutes or until done (no pink remains,160 degrees F), turning to brown evenly.
